Huevos Rancheros

Cultural Context

Huevos Rancheros is a traditional Mexican breakfast dish that reflects the country's rich culinary heritage. It typically features eggs served on tortillas with a variety of toppings, showcasing local ingredients like beans and salsa. The dish is often enjoyed in the morning but can be served at any time of the day, highlighting its versatility and popularity across Mexico and beyond.

4 large eggs
1 cup refried beans
1 lb carnitas
8 corn tortillas
2 medium tomatoes
1 teaspoon oregano
1/2 teaspoon allspice
1/4 teaspoon clove
2 dried hot peppers
1 medium onion
2 cloves garlic
1/4 cup cilantro

1

Soak the dried hot peppers in water for a little while to reconstitute them.

2

Grind the dried spices (oregano, allspice, clove) until fine.

3

Blend the tomatoes, onion, and garlic together until smooth using a stick blender.

4

Add the reconstituted hot peppers to the blender along with the ground spices and blend until smooth.

5

Reserve the soaking liquid from the hot peppers for later use.

6

Strain the blended mixture to remove seeds for a better texture.

7

Heat a little oil in a pan and add the strained sauce, cooking it down until thickened, stirring occasionally.

8

While the sauce is cooking, cook the eggs sunny-side up in a separate pan.

9

Warm the carnitas in a pan until the fat melts and they are heated through.

10

Assemble the dish by placing refried beans on a plate, followed by a crispy corn tortilla, sunny-side up eggs, and the ranchero sauce on top.

11

Garnish with cilantro and serve.
